Output 580bbff98846ec52b1a025c107864e79dc56fe1783f84a5c905f72aaa0f6fd96:3

value
1077930
script pubkey
OP_0 OP_PUSHBYTES_20 b5672881bcdc2f88ef011a7e27ab37026f305efb
address
bc1qk4nj3qdumshc3mcprflz02ehqfhnqhhmdfzcke
transaction
580bbff98846ec52b1a025c107864e79dc56fe1783f84a5c905f72aaa0f6fd96